> > Generally http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Disjoint-set_data_structure
> > In my program it's a tree for each group of stones. In the root is
> > number of pseudoliberties.
> > Joining is cheap and checking group membership is cheap.

> I had done similar once upon a time in my bot and later moved away from
> the disjoint set approach because of the headache that undo created.
Undo can be done efficiently exactly like in Gnu Go.
> Out of curiosity, is this library intended to support MC clients
> specifically or other types of searches (such as alpha-beta that tends
> to back up its search frequently?
Basically I wanted to implement a board in a hope that more people get
attracted to Computer Go. But now this is more or less accomplished.
So I decided to implement some kind of set canonical algorithms.
But only those most common, I do not intend to make another GnuGo :)
I just started UCT, as majority voted for it. Maybe patterns will come next.
